Xi Jinping: Held 'in-depth, friendly and fruitful' talks with President Putin
Chinese President Xi Jinping and Russian President Vladimir Putin met in Moscow on Thursday, May 8, 2025, for a high-profile state visit that underscored efforts to strengthen bilateral ties. The meeting comes amid growing trade pressures from the United States and skepticism from European allies.Xi Jinping, upon arrival at Moscow's Vnukovo-2 airport, expressed confidence that the visit would deepen bilateral cooperation between China and Russia. He stated, "I will meet with President Putin to have an in-depth exchange of views over bilateral relations, practical cooperation, as well as major international and regional issues of mutual interest" [2]. This visit is expected to inject strong impetus into the growth of the China-Russia comprehensive strategic partnership of coordination for the new era.
During the meeting, Xi Jinping vowed to stand alongside Putin in defending the rights and interests of developing countries. He emphasized the need to promote a multipolar world that is equal and orderly, as well as economic globalization that is inclusive and beneficial for all. "We will defend the rights and interests of China, Russia, and other developing countries, and work together to promote a multipolar world that is equal and orderly, as well as economic globalization that is inclusive and beneficial for all," Xi said [1].
The visit also comes amidst geopolitical tensions, with local authorities reporting that a number of Ukrainian drones were brought down near the capital, and airports across Moscow were temporarily shut down hours before Xi's arrival [2].
The meeting highlights the continued strengthening of the China-Russia alliance, which is expected to have significant implications for global trade and political dynamics.
